草庐IT

ios - 图片IO : CreateMetadataFromXMPBufferInternal Threw error

我的iPad应用程序一直在日志中显示此消息......:ImageIO:CreateMetadataFromXMPBufferInternalThrewerror#203(Duplicatepropertyorfieldnode)它似乎对应用程序没有任何功能影响。我用Google搜索了这个错误,只返回了大约5个匹配项,而且没有一个适用于iOS。知道是什么原因造成的以及如何处理/停止记录吗? 最佳答案 我刚遇到同样的问题。当您尝试使用imageWithContentsOfFile读取JPEG文件时,这似乎发生在iOS7中。作为解决方法

ios - 在 UILabel et.al 中使用 NSString 子类

我需要将额外的数据编码到NSString(说来话长,请不要问为什么...)我使用here中概述的方法对NSString进行了子类化:当我将这些子类之一指定为UILabel's文本时,我希望在询问标签文本时能取回它。但事实并非如此。(我得到一个NSString集群实例)MyString*string=[[MyStringalloc]initWithString:@"Somestring"];UILabel*l=[[UILabelalloc]initWithFrame:CGRectMake(0,0,100,100)];l.text=string;NSString*t=l.text;//no

ios - 应用程序尝试在打印前使用 UIModalTransitionStyleCoverVertical 以外的过渡样式呈现内部弹出窗口

我正在尝试从iPad8.x应用程序中打印一个txt文件。所以,我有这段代码:-(void)onOpenWith:(UIButton*)theButtonpath:(NSString*)path{NSURL*URL=[NSURLfileURLWithPath:path];if(URL){self.documentInteractionController=[UIDocumentInteractionControllerinteractionControllerWithURL:URL];self.documentInteractionController.delegate=self;[se

iOS 核心音频 : Converting between kAudioFormatFlagsCanonical and kAudioFormatFlagsAudioUnitCanonical

我需要在这种格式之间进行转换:format.mSampleRate=44100.0;format.mFormatID=kAudioFormatLinearPCM;format.mFormatFlags=kAudioFormatFlagsCanonical|kLinearPCMFormatFlagIsNonInterleaved;format.mBytesPerPacket=sizeof(AudioUnitSampleType);format.mFramesPerPacket=1;format.mBytesPerFrame=sizeof(AudioUnitSampleType);form

hadoop - ALS.checkpointInterval 和 SparkContext.setCheckpointDir

我试图查找什么ALS.checkpointInterval确实如此,但它不是很能解释。设置ALS.checkpointInterval和设置sc.setCheckpointDir()有什么区别?两者都是必要的,还是它们的工作方式不同? 最佳答案 SparkContext.setCheckpointDir用于设置全局检查点目录。它不限于ALS或任何其他特定算法,但它是RDD.checkpoint工作所必需的。ALS.checkpointInterval是算法特定的属性,不会影响任何全局设置。来自机器学习文档:Paramforsetch

android - 适用于 Android 的 AzureAD 抛出 ADALError.AUTH_REFRESH_FAILED_PROMPT_NOT_ALLOWED

我有一个应用程序,用户在Office365中使用AzureADlibraryforAndroid进行身份验证.它运作良好,用户可以验证并使用该应用程序。不幸的是,过了一会儿,他们开始使用ADALError.AUTH_REFRESH_FAILED_PROMPT_NOT_ALLOWED作为错误代码命中AuthenticationException。我检查了sourcecodeAzurelAD。唯一解决这个问题的地方是acquireTokenAfterValidation()方法:privateAuthenticationResultacquireTokenAfterValidation(C

windows - apache mahout ALS 可以在没有 hadoop 的情况下工作吗?

我尝试使用ParallelALSFactorizationJob,但它在这里崩溃了:线程“main”中的异常java.lang.NullPointerException在java.lang.ProcessBuilder.start(ProcessBuilder.java:1012)在org.apache.hadoop.util.Shell.runCommand(Shell.java:445)在org.apache.hadoop.util.Shell.run(Shell.java:418)在org.apache.hadoop.util.Shell$ShellCommandExecutor

windows - 任务无法使用 SdkToolsPath 找到 "AL.exe"

我有这个问题想构建一个解决方案任务无法使用SdkToolsPath“C:\ProgramFiles\MicrosoftSDKs\Windows\v7.0A\bin\NETFX4.0Tools\”或注册表项“H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ft”找到“AL.exe”SDKs\Windows\v7.0A”。确保设置了SdkToolsPath,并且该工具存在于SdkToolsPath下正确的处理器特定位置,并且安装了MicrosoftWindowsSDK我知道有一个类似的问题,但答案对我不起作用在同一台电脑上a可以在Net4中构建其他

java - 面向对象 : Difference between ArrayList al = new ArrayList() and List al = new ArrayList()?

这个问题在这里已经有了答案:关闭11年前。PossibleDuplicate:ListversusArrayList之间的区别ArrayListal=newArrayList()和Listal=newArrayList()?

python - 通过 pyspark.ml CrossValidator 调整隐式 pyspark.ml ALS 矩阵分解模型的参数

我正在尝试调整使用隐式数据的ALS矩阵分解模型的参数。为此,我尝试使用pyspark.ml.tuning.CrossValidator来运行参数网格并选择最佳模型。我相信我的问题出在评估者身上,但我想不通。我可以使用回归RMSE评估器将其用于显式数据模型,如下所示:frompysparkimportSparkConf,SparkContextfrompyspark.sqlimportSQLContextfrompyspark.ml.recommendationimportALSfrompyspark.ml.tuningimportCrossValidator,ParamGridBuil